Asset banks can be used in Skyrim mods? by chlamydia1 in skyrimmods

[–]pndrad 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Ensure you set your permissions to none if you buy assets. There is also Fab, the paid asset store half of SketchFab, a lot of it works only for Unreal and unity so check before you buy or use free assets from there.

Asset banks can be used in Skyrim mods? by chlamydia1 in skyrimmods

[–]pndrad 1 point2 points  (0 children)

NetImmerse File format is a a proprietary format, you should be able to use files from CGTrader in a mod, so long as the license is Royalty Free. You can not make those files a modder's resource however as you are sharing those files with others to reuse thus breaking the terms of service. Some model creators will still get mad at you, so its better to ask before buying.

There are tools to extract files from almost every game engine, some engine editors will actually allow you to export files.

That being said SketchFab has some models you can download, check the license that the creator has released the model under.
